This **1994-built**, **3-story 3LDK** in **Adachi 4-Chome** is only a **4-minute walk to Gotanno Station** and about 20 minutes from Tokyo Station. With 73 sqm of bright, functional living space on a 66 sqm corner lot, it’s a turnkey option in one of Tokyo’s most convenient and improving residential wards.\n\n![](https://utfs.io/f/UVgsUOm7zpHeiMwgaC7CXmpch4KP9My87d1R6ql0SAtI2BFG)## 🛠️ Property Features & Highlights\n\n- 🏠 **Three-story 3LDK layout** with bright rooms and excellent separation of space\n- 🪟 **Renovated double-pane windows** for quieter living and improved insulation\n- 🛁 **Bathroom + vanity + laundry space** on the first floor, clean and ready to use\n- 🚽 **Two toilets**: one on the first floor, one on the second floor\n- 🌞 **Balconies on both the 2F and 3F**, including a third-floor view of Tokyo Skytree\n- 🧳 **Strong storage throughout**: Large closets on the 1F and 3F, attic space on the 3F, compact outdoor storage chest near the water heater\n- 🍳 **Refreshed system kitchen** with solid counter space, good storage, and natural light\n- 🌬️ **Corner-lot ventilation** that keeps the home airy and bright\n- 🚉 **Transit access**: 4 minutes to Gotanno Station; walkable to Kosuge and Umejima\n- 🛠️ **Recent improvements**: Kitchen, bathroom, toilet, exterior waterproofing, and double-pane windows\n\n![](https://utfs.io/f/UVgsUOm7zpHeAW28MZqz67iZbeKSJ2v1c4WTqmjlU08Bufxh)## 📍 Adachi-ku: A Spacious, Diverse, Convenient Tokyo District\n\nAdachi-ku is one of Tokyo’s largest wards, offering rare breathing room while still keeping you well-connected to the city center. The area combines wide **residential streets**, easy **daily conveniences**, and quick **links to major hubs**, making it a practical base for commuters and families alike.\n\nTransit access is one of its strongest advantages. With **eight rail lines** running through the ward, including the Tobu Isesaki Line, JR Joban Line, Tokyo Metro Chiyoda and Hibiya Lines, and the Nippori-Toneri Liner, you can reach Otemachi, Ueno, Asakusa, and Tokyo Station with minimal transfers. **From Gotanno Station, you’re just minutes from fast connections** at Kita-Senju.\n\nNeighborhood convenience is also a major plus. Around Gotanno, you’ll find **supermarkets**, **drugstores**, **cafés**, and friendly **shopping streets**, while nearby hubs like Kita-Senju offer full department stores, malls, and dining. Daily life is refreshingly easy in this part of the city.\n\n![](https://utfs.io/f/UVgsUOm7zpHemIcJjm5POXofKa1td4ARvNLwmj7JbWMG23ZF)## 🌸 Welcome to Adachi-ku\n\nAdachi’s lifestyle appeal comes from its balance of space, greenery, and community. Parks like Toneri Park and the Urban Agricultural Park bring seasonal **flowers**, **playgrounds**, and **wide open lawns** to a part of Tokyo where outdoor room is often limited.\n\nThe ward is also one of Tokyo’s **most multicultural areas**, home to more than 33,000 foreign residents. That diversity shows up in **local events**, **food culture**, and a generally **welcoming atmosphere** for newcomers. Whether you’re arriving from abroad or moving across Tokyo, settling in here feels straightforward.\n\nSecurity and comfort continue to impress across the ward, supported by **neighborhood lighting** and **safety patrols**.
